June mystery quilt

 


 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

This is a fairly simple strip quilt, however, the instructions seemed a little wordy so we decided to do them on the blog where we can post some photos as we go along.  Here goes--

Use an accurate ¼ seam throughout this project. 

Pull the Teal strips with the little white posies from the jelly roll and set aside. (We have cut and extra strip of this print for your kit so you should have 3 strips.) These strips will form the cross pieces through the quilt.)


 

 

 

 

 

 

Sew strips together along the length to create the following sets:

One set of 15 strips

One set of 8 strips

Two sets of 7 strips. This should leave one strip from the Jelly Roll which will be used later.

 Press the strip sets.

 Trim the selvedge from both ends of the set of 15 strips making sure the unit measures 42 inches long.

Measure the width of the 15-strip set (should be 30 ½ inches).  Cut a 30 ½ inch piece (or whatever yours measured) from the 8-strip section. 

Cut the same length from one of the teal strips. Sew the teal strip to the top of the 15-strip section.  

 Sew the 8-strip unit to the top of this. (The 15 strips will be oriented vertically and the other section will be oriented horizontally.

 


 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Cut a 16 ½ inch section from one of the 7-strip units. Cut two 16 ½ inch lengths from the remaining 2 ½ inch jelly roll strip (not the teal strips). Sew one to each side of the 16 ½ inch piece, matching the direction of the strips.   

 


 

 

 

 

 

Sew an 18 ½ inch teal strip across the bottom of the section.  (The strips should be oriented vertically with the teal strip oriented horizontally across the bottom.)

 


 

 

 

 

 

 

 

From the remaining 7-strip pieces cut three 18 ½ inch sections.  Sew these together with the strips oriented horizontally. 

Sew this section to the bottom of the section 16 ½ x 18 ½ inch section created above.

 


 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Join teal strips to create a strip the length of the quilt (should be about 58 ½ inches.) Sew the two sections of the quilt together with the teal strip between making sure the teal strips match up correctly at their intersection.

Applique the flower on the intersection of the teal strips if desired. (We pieced leftover prints to create the center of the flower.)

Quilt as desired.  Bind and enjoy!

Country Summer - Second Sat. Sampler

 Block 12 - the last one

They say, "Time flies when you're having fun". We must have had a lot of fun because the last 12 months have come and gone so quickly. Thanks for accompanying us on this quilting journey.
 

 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
For this block you will need:
 

12) 2 ½” red squares

24) 2 ½” background squares

8) 2 ½" x 4 ½" green 

4) 2 ½" x 4 ½" (You provide these, use your choice of color. They are the gold check in photo.)

4) 4 ½” black, check squares

1) 4 ½” gray square 

 
Sewing:
Draw a diagonal line on the back of 16) 2 1/2" background squares.   
 
Place a background square on the end of a 2 1/2" x 4 1/2" green rectangle with the right sides together and the outside edges aligned.  Sew on the line.  Trim 1/4" from the sewn line and press.  Create 4 units with the angles facing this direction.


 

 

 

Create 4 more units with the angles on the opposite side.


 Use 2) 2 1/2" red squares and 2) 2 1/2" background squares to create 4) four-patch units.

 

  Use two of the green units, a four-patch, and an additional red 2 1/2" square to create 4 of the units shown below.
 
 
 
 
 Place a 2 1/2" background square (with the drawn diagonal line) on a corner of a 4 1/2" black check square. Make sure the right sides are together and the outside edges are aligned with the drawn line going from edge to edge. Sew on the line.  Trim 1/4" from the line and press back.  Repeat on the other corner of the check square.
 


Create 4 of these units.
 
Sew a 2 1/2" x 4 1/2" rectangle to the pointed side of each of these units.
 
Use the photo at the top to arrange the components and sew the block together.
 
Sew the block to the bottom of the house row.
 
Sew 36)  2 1/2" scrappy squares into a row.  Sew these to the right side of the last column.  Sew this column to the rest of the quilt.
 
To border the quilt we cut a 2" first border and a 6" final border.
